Queensland Police Commissioner Steve Gollschewski has resigned due to a recent cancer diagnosis. The announcement came unexpectedly, cutting short his tenure which began in April of the previous year. Gollschewski's time as commissioner was marked by his efforts in navigating the state through floods, COVID-19, and addressing issues of sexism and racism within the police service. He also oversaw the recruitment of over 3,000 officers and emphasized tackling domestic and family violence. Deputy Commissioner Shane Chelepy will immediately take over as acting commissioner.
